Pros & cons

Mintlify
Pros
  • +Cleanest developer docs sites in the category — beautiful by default
  • +AI chat agent grounded on your docs improves user retention
  • +Auto-generates docs from OpenAPI/code annotations
Cons
  • Best for API-first products — less differentiated for general docs
  • Pro tier required for any production use ($20/mo minimum)
  • Migration from Docusaurus or GitBook takes a focused day
Tabnine
Pros
  • +Strongest privacy story in the coding-agent category — fully self-hostable
  • +Models can be fine-tuned on your private codebase without sending data out
  • +Long history of enterprise deployments in regulated industries
Cons
  • Capability gap vs frontier models in chat/agent quality
  • Less polished UX than Cursor or GitHub Copilot
  • Per-seat pricing at Enterprise is high vs alternatives
